the volume of the triangular prism is 54 cubic units. what is the value of x?
○ 3
○ 5
○ 7
○ 9
(there is a diagram of a triangular prism with a right triangle base where one leg is 4, the height of the triangle is x, and the length of the prism is 3x)

Explanation:

Step1: Recall the volume formula for a triangular prism

The volume formula for a triangular prism is \(V = B\times h\), where \(B\) is the area of the triangular base and \(h\) is the height (length) of the prism. The area of a triangle \(B=\frac{1}{2}\times base\times height\). Here, the base of the triangular base is \(4\) and its height is \(x\), so \(B = \frac{1}{2}\times4\times x=2x\). The height (length) of the prism \(h = 3x\).

Step2: Substitute into the volume formula

Substitute \(B = 2x\) and \(h=3x\) into \(V=B\times h\). We get \(V=(2x)\times(3x)=6x^{2}\).

Step3: Solve for \(x\)

Since \(V = 54\), we have the equation \(6x^{2}=54\). Divide both sides by \(6\): \(x^{2}=\frac{54}{6}=9\). Take the square root of both sides: \(x=\sqrt{9}=3\) (we consider the positive value since \(x\) represents a length).

Answer:

A. 3
